Common Engineered Wood Installation Jobs
Engineered Wood Flooring - provides a durable and attractive surface for living areas and bedrooms.
Subfloor Preparation - ensures a stable and level foundation for engineered wood installation.
Floating Floor Installation - allows for quick setup and easy replacement of engineered wood planks.
Glue-Down Installation - secures engineered wood to the subfloor for added stability and longevity.
Underlayment Installation - enhances soundproofing and moisture resistance for engineered wood floors.
Repair and Replacement - restores damaged engineered wood flooring to maintain its appearance and function.
Engineered Wood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for engineered wood installation? Engineered wood is ideal for flooring, remodeling, and new construction projects in residential and commercial spaces.
How does engineered wood differ from solid hardwood? Engineered wood features a layered construction that provides greater stability and resistance to moisture compared to solid hardwood.
What should property owners consider before installing engineered wood? It's important to evaluate the subfloor condition, moisture levels, and the intended use of the space to ensure proper installation.
Is engineered wood suitable for areas with high humidity? Yes, engineered wood performs well in humid environments due to its layered construction, which reduces expansion and contraction.
